Woodcut and collograph // Jim Dine's Transparent Grey Robe is a captivating limited-edition mixed-media print from 2013. Using woodcut and collograph techniques, Dine creates an abstract yet deeply personal representation of a robe, one of his signature motifs. The vibrant layers of red, purple, and subtle yellow tones swirl and blend to form the robe's structure, giving it a sense of movement and emotional depth. The overlapping colors and textural elements create a luminous, almost ethereal quality, despite the darker undertones. The robe, often seen as a stand-in for the artist’s own presence, invites reflection on identity, vulnerability, and memory. Measuring 54 cm by 36.75 cm, the piece exemplifies Dine's ability to merge everyday objects with expressive, abstract forms.

What is pop-art?
Pop Art is an art movement that began in Britain in 1955 and in the late 1950s in the U.S. It challenged traditional fine arts by incorporating imagery from popular culture, such as news, advertising, and comic books. Pop Art often isolates and recontextualizes materials, combining them with unrelated elements. The movement is more about the attitudes and ideas that inspired it than the specific art itself. Pop Art is seen as a reaction against the dominant ideas of Abstract Expressionism, bringing everyday consumer culture into the realm of fine art.
